Output 093ed9389a715cce802648b7adad6e726e4e768dc969fa4674b2392934d84252:5

value
156797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c655986098b48175738e1777e14644c6b1854e OP_EQUAL
address
3BLJUCUPscYNQVC7iYiZXeJGsQBepLy39A
transaction
093ed9389a715cce802648b7adad6e726e4e768dc969fa4674b2392934d84252
spent
true